Teaching tips for The Gupta Period
- 1Organize a class discussion on the significance of Nalanda University in ancient education.
- 2Encourage students to create a timeline of major events during the Gupta period.
- 3Use visual aids like images of Ajanta Caves to discuss Gupta art and architecture.
- 4Assign a project on the contributions of Aryabhata to mathematics and astronomy.
Board exam relevance
Questions may include MCQs on key figures, short answer questions on achievements, and map work identifying important locations of the Gupta period.
